Lab
7
—Flash and EEPROM demo
This lab will show how to use Flash and EEPROM typical operational commands: Erase Verify All Blocks,
Erase Verify Flash/EEPROM block, Erase Verify Flash/EEPROM section, Program EEPROM/Flash, Erase
EEPROM/Flash sector, Erase EEPROM/Flash block, Erase all blocks. Follow steps below to play with this
demo:
1.
Make sure the latest P&E OSBDM Virtual Serial Toolkit is installed. Please refer to TWR-S08PT60
Quick Start Guide for installation details
2.
Make sure the board is powered with USB connection and the S08PT60_Flash_Lab code is
downloaded into the board.
3.
Open P&E Terminal Utility, configure properties as below followed by clicking on
“
Open Serial Port
”
:
Port: USB COM; Baud: 9600; Parity: None; Bits: 8
4.
Press and release SW4 (RESET) button, the welcome message and the commands list will be
printed on Terminal.
5.
Enter
“
help
”
in the command line beginning with
“CMD>”.
The command list will be printed on
Terminal.
6.
Enter the command
“
ev_fb fc00
”
to erase verify (blank check) the whole flash block containing
address 0xfc00, where
“
fc00
”
is the address in hex in the flash block. The following message will be
shown as a result of the command:
“EraseVerify
flash
block
failed
(i.e.,
flash
is
not
blank)!”
. This is
correct because the flash block contains code that is running.
7.
Enter the command
“
ev_eep 3100
”
to erase verify (blank check) the whole EEPROM block
containing address 0x3100. The following message will be shown as a result of this command
:
“EraseVerify
EEPROM
block
success
(EEPROM
is
blank)!”
. This is correct because the EEPROM block
has not been programmed.
8.
Enter the command
“
ev_fs fc00 10
”
to erase verify (blank check) the flash section starting from
0xfc00 with size of 10 longwords. The following message will be shown as a result of the command:
“EraseVerify
flash
section
success
(flash
section
is
blank)!”
This is correct because this flash section has
not been programmed.
9.
Enter the command
“
ev_fs 3200 100
”
to erase verify (blank check) the flash section starting from
0x3200 with size of 100 longwords. The following message will be shown as a result of the
command:
“EraseVerify
flash
section
failed
(i.e.,
flash
section
is
not
blank)!”
This is correct because this
flash section has been programmed with the LAB code.
